Ducker: 80s Inspired Arcade Game

Created with Processing and Arduino

Concept

‘Ducker’ is my modern take on the classic 1980s arcade game Frogger, which I built with Processing and Arduino.

Players control the duck’s movement using up, down, left, and right buttons, navigating through traffic and leaping onto logs to reach the top.

However, not everything is as it seems… The button direction controls switch around, giving the player a sense of limited control of the game.

The project explores how we, as humans, exert control over our lives and how we perceive our level of control. For example, how are our choices and actions influenced by others, by rules, or by external factors, like our environment?
